Two detained in Tajikistan on suspicion of committing murder in Russia

Asia-Plus

The Interior Ministry of Tajikistan says the 16-year-old resident of Rasht district (Rasht Valley in eastern Tajikistan) and the 29-year-old resident of Dushanbe were arrested on September 30 on suspicion of killing and robbing another Tajik national in the Russian city of Mytishchi.

The suspects reportedly attacked their roommate, the 27-year-old resident of Dousti district, Khatlon province, and killed him.  They seized his money and fled to Tajikistan, where they were detained.

The ministry does not give further details of this crime, just noting that criminal proceedings have been instituted and an investigation is under way. 

The ministry also does not release the attackers’ names, may be because the Rasht resident is a minor and police are unable to release his name

The resident of Dushanbe faces 15 to 25 years in prison or life imprisonment, while the resident of Rasht district faces up to 10 years in prison because he is a minor.
